Burkina Faso has parted ways with their French coach Velud Hubert. The Stallions reached the Round 16th Stage of the 2023 AFCON where they lost 2-1 to Mali.
The Football Association of Burkina Faso thinks the Stallions have the potential to go further than the Round 16 hence have decided to part ways.
Velud Hubert, 64, has known the African terrain since 2009 when he landed his first job as the head coach of the Togo National Team. He has since gone ahead to coach clubs like TP Mazembe, Etoile du Sahel, JSK, USM Algier, ES Setif, Hassania Agadir and Constantine.
Valid Hubert has been in charge of the Stallions of Burkina Faso since 2022 and he was tasked to at least reach the semi-finals of the 2023 AFCON.
